Wechaty Web Panel 常见问题解决方案
项目基础介绍
Wechaty Web Panel 是一个开源项目,旨在为 Wechaty 机器人提供一个快速接入的 Web 可视化操作面板。该项目的主要编程语言是 JavaScript,使用了 Node.js 作为运行环境。通过这个项目,开发者可以轻松地为他们的 Wechaty 机器人添加 Web 控制面板,实现诸如定时提醒、智能机器人、定时任务、技能中心等功能。
新手使用注意事项及解决方案
1. 依赖安装问题
问题描述:新手在安装项目依赖时可能会遇到安装时间过长或安装失败的问题。
解决方案:
- 步骤1:确保你的网络环境良好,可以尝试使用淘宝镜像源加速安装。
npm install --registry=https://registry.npmmirror.com - 步骤2:如果仍然安装失败,可以尝试手动安装依赖包。
npm install wechaty-web-panel@latest wechaty@latest --save - 步骤3:检查 Node.js 版本是否符合项目要求(Node.js > 16)。
2. API Key 和 API Secret 配置问题
问题描述:新手在配置 API Key 和 API Secret 时可能会遇到配置错误或找不到配置文件的问题。
解决方案:
- 步骤1:在
test/wechat.js文件中填入正确的 API Key 和 API Secret。const apiKey = 'your_api_key'; const apiSecret = 'your_api_secret'; - 步骤2:确保配置文件路径正确,通常配置文件位于项目根目录下的
config文件夹中。 - 步骤3:运行测试命令验证配置是否正确。
npm run test:wechat
3. 定时任务和智能机器人功能不生效
问题描述:新手在配置定时任务或智能机器人功能时,可能会发现功能不生效。
解决方案:
- 步骤1:检查定时任务的配置是否正确,确保时间格式和命令格式符合要求。
"提醒 我 每天 18:00 下班了 记得带好随身物品" - 步骤2:确保智能机器人相关的 API 配置正确,例如天行机器人、图灵机器人等。
- 步骤3:检查日志输出,查看是否有错误信息提示,根据错误信息进行相应的调整。
通过以上解决方案,新手可以更好地理解和使用 Wechaty Web Panel 项目,避免常见问题的困扰。
创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考



